Welcome to Democracy Now, Democracy Now.org, the war in peace report. I may be goodman. In Texas, a man armed with a semi-automatic rifle killed eight people and injured seven others Saturday at a suburban shopping mall outside Dallas before he was shot dead by a police officer.

2:35.0

The hospital's treated victims as young as five is older 61. Among the dead were Christian Lacourt, a 20-year-old security guard at the mall and a Shwaria Tatyikaanda, a 27-year-old engineer from India whose fiance was injured and had two bullets removed from his body.

2:51.0

One young boy was found alive beneath the body of his mother who died protecting him. Over a hundred spent shell casings were recovered from the scene.

2:59.0

Authorities haven't yet cited a motive but are investigating whether the 33-year-old gunman had ties to white supremacist groups. He wore tactical gear and a patch on his chest reading, R-W-D-S, for right-wing death squad, a slogan popular among neo-nazis.

3:16.0

As Texas Governor Greg Abbott spoke Sunday at a prayer vigil in Allen, protesters outside demanded reforms to gun laws.

3:24.0

Meanwhile in Brownsville, Texas, eight people were killed at least ten others injured Sunday after an SUV plowed into a group of pedestrians near a shelter for migrants and unhoused people not far from the US-Mexico border.

3:38.0

The driver was treated for injuries and rested for reckless driving though is likely to face additional charges. Investigators say the drivers are feising to identify himself as not cooperating with their probe and to whether the killings were intentional.
